HarmonyOS鸿蒙Next中js ui的日志输出在哪里呀?为没有找到望解答
HarmonyOS鸿蒙Next中js ui的日志输出在哪里呀?为没有找到望解答
如图,希望大家可以解答一下,在开发工具哪个位置会被打印输出
更多关于HarmonyOS鸿蒙Next中js ui的日志输出在哪里呀?为没有找到望解答的实战教程也可以访问 https://www.itying.com/category-93-b0.html
上面错误日志是系统日志,不影响开发和测试。
更多关于HarmonyOS鸿蒙Next中js ui的日志输出在哪里呀?为没有找到望解答的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
亲爱滴开发者 ,这个问题已经在处理中啦,稍后答复你哟 ,么么哒
当我输出日志的时候开始报这个错了,需要哪里配置呀?
W/FastPrintWriter: Write failure
java.io.IOException: write failed: EPIPE (Broken pipe)
at libcore.io.IoBridge.write(IoBridge.java:544)
at java.io.FileOutputStream.write(FileOutputStream.java:392)
at com.android.internal.util.FastPrintWriter.flushBytesLocked(FastPrintWriter.java:354)
at com.android.internal.util.FastPrintWriter.flushLocked(FastPrintWriter.java:377)
at com.android.internal.util.FastPrintWriter.flush(FastPrintWriter.java:412)
at android.app.ActivityThread.handleDumpActivity(ActivityThread.java:4741)
at android.app.ActivityThread.access$3600(ActivityThread.java:251)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2390)
at android.os.Handler.dispatchMessage(Handler.java:110)
at android.os.Looper.loop(Looper.java:219)
at android.app.ActivityThread.main(ActivityThread.java:8380)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:513)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1083)
Caused by: android.system.ErrnoException: write failed: EPIPE (Broken pipe)
at libcore.io.Linux.writeBytes(Native Method)
at libcore.io.Linux.write(Linux.java:294)
at libcore.io.ForwardingOs.write(ForwardingOs.java:241)
at libcore.io.BlockGuardOs.write(BlockGuardOs.java:416)
at libcore.io.ForwardingOs.write(ForwardingOs.java:241)
at libcore.io.IoBridge.write(IoBridge.java:539)
可以参考下面,输出到HiLog中。
在HarmonyOS鸿蒙Next中,JS UI的日志输出可以通过console.log
、console.info
、console.warn
和console.error
等方法进行。这些日志信息默认会输出到系统的日志系统中。你可以通过以下方式查看这些日志:
-
使用DevEco Studio的Logcat工具:在DevEco Studio中,打开Logcat窗口,选择对应的设备或模拟器,即可查看JS UI的日志输出。Logcat会显示所有通过
console
方法输出的日志信息。 -
使用命令行工具:你可以通过
hdc
(HarmonyOS Device Connector)工具连接到设备,并使用hilog
命令查看日志。例如,运行hdc shell hilog
可以实时查看设备上的日志输出。 -
日志级别过滤:在Logcat或
hilog
中,你可以通过日志级别(如DEBUG
、INFO
、WARN
、ERROR
)来过滤日志,以便更快速地找到JS UI的日志信息。 -
自定义日志标签:在JS代码中,你可以通过
console
方法的第一个参数指定日志标签,例如console.log("MyTag", "Log message")
,这样在查看日志时可以通过标签进行过滤。
通过这些方法,你可以方便地查看HarmonyOS鸿蒙Next中JS UI的日志输出。
在HarmonyOS鸿蒙Next中,使用JS UI开发时,日志输出可以通过console.log()
方法进行打印。这些日志信息可以在DevEco Studio的Logcat窗口中查看。具体步骤如下:
- 打开DevEco Studio。
- 连接设备或启动模拟器。
- 在底部工具栏中点击“Logcat”标签。
- 在Logcat窗口中选择对应的设备和应用进程,即可查看JS UI的日志输出。